Use versatile furniture when you are decorating a room that is small. For example, you could use ottomans rather than actual chairs or sofas. The ottoman will not only serve as seating, but also as a place to store things. Using things that have two purposes could help you maximize a small space.

The amount of natural light available in a room plays a big role in the way its interior should be designed. If you are lacking in window area in your room, you should consider using a light shade to prevent your room from looking too dark.

Think about your room’s purpose when you decorate it. Consider the number of people you will have in the room at once and what they’ll use it for. Think about family and friends when you design a living room, but focus on the personality of your couple when making changes to your bedroom.

Wallpaper just half your room. Redecorating walls can set you back a bit of money. A way to save money is by only cover half the wall. Give your wallpaper a nice border and paint the rest. This is an excellent method of maintaining a stylish-looking home while saving money at the bank.

Don’t rush through the wall paint color on a whim. Rushing could cause you to make some poor color you’ll eventually loathe. See how everything comes together under different lighting. You might find that you don’t love a color quite as much as you did before.

Getting rid of clutter is the number one thing you should focus on. Go through all of the stuff in the room and get rid of what you no longer have a use for. Give your excess things to charity, a recycling center, or have a yard sale and earn some cash off them!

Lighting is critical in any home. It creates the mood. Bright lights tend to project a more positive vibe and work well suited for bathrooms and kitchens. Try adding dim lighting to bedrooms and living rooms if you want a mood like that.

Get rid of clutter to make your rooms feel bigger. Try getting nice storage that will prevent clutter your room. A small box leaves much more free space than having things scattered around everywhere.

Remember to follow trends in accessories and accents, not in your expensive pieces or overall design. Once-popular leopard sheets can easily be changed out for the trend of the day. A sofa with zebra print isn’t as easy to change.

The use of area rugs in a room can make a beautiful difference in the appearance of the room. You just have to be sure that the rug fits the room. In bigger rooms, make sure you get a large enough area rug for the room so it looks as if it belongs there. Then again, smaller rooms need smaller rugs since a big one could take up the entire room.

Be careful of hanging your artwork at the correct height. A good practice is to hang the art between 8 and 10 inches above major pieces of your sofa.

Light colors will be good for a smaller kitchen when thinking of fixing up the interior of your home. Not only should you chose light tones, but neutrals are really the best way to go, like eggshell or ivory. Dark colors actually make a room look smaller.
